Deanston 12yo 2008 Oloroso Cask Matured is a limited release from the Highland distillery.
Mixed between Oloroso sherry casks and Port pipes influence. The fruity aspect is both red and black, with cherry, strawberry, blackberry and dark plums. Sugary at moments, it alternates darker and deeper sides. Fruity gelee candies. Tannic in a sense and with some balsamic vinegar glaze hints.
The sip is pretty heavy on the winey side, with tannins showing their strong character. Intensity is good, but the influence of the wine is rather marking. Even a slightly chemical sweetness, rather artificial such as in hard fruity candies, can be found in some sips. The dark chocolate dimension is probably the best one.
Medium duration, again on wet polished oak and winey aftertaste.
Deanston 12yo 2008 Oloroso Cask Matured is a release performing relatively well on the nose, with a nice mix of red/black berries and some port-like wine character. The sip is on the contrary quite market by the wine finish, lacking some refinement and balance. A young product, which is muscular but not as silky as desirable.
